Thanks for the guidance, FireGuard. I assembled mine today, and plan to install on Wednesday. My instructions don't say how much torque to apply to the Nylock nut on the 2-1/2" bolt that holds the shim pack together. Did you just snug it up? It seems too tight would interfere with the engagement.
I have a 2012 F350 and had to remove the top wedge plate and use 6 washer shims. I do have airbags and plan to have ~25 psi when I engage, which gives me 1/2" gap front and 3/8" rear. I probably could have left the top in the front, but wanted a contingency in case I have to engage without inflation.
